Update downloader's Etag to last successful act value

Earlier the client would reset the etag on the downloader
in case of downloader errors and bundle activation failures.
The drawback of this approach is that OPA could potentially download
the same version of a bundle multiple times thereby unnecessarily
adding to network traffic.

This change resolves the issue by allowing the client to set
the etag on the downloader to the last successful activation
etag value in case of failures.
